Comprehensive Guide to Prenatal History Form

What is the Prenatal History Form?

The prenatal history form is a crucial tool used by healthcare providers to collect comprehensive prenatal information from patients during their initial visits. Gathering detailed information on a patient's health history is vital for ensuring safe and effective medical care throughout pregnancy. The form typically includes several sections, such as general patient information, obstetric history, present pregnancy details, gynecologic history, and laboratory data.

Who Needs to Complete the Prenatal History Form?

The primary audience for the prenatal history form includes expectant mothers and their healthcare providers. It is essential for patients to fill out the form during their first prenatal visit, ensuring that all relevant health history is documented from the outset. Certain patient circumstances, such as high-risk pregnancies, may require additional considerations and details be included on the form to ensure comprehensive care.
